Tim Sherwood says Guardiola is the 'best coach' in Premier League history ahead of Sir Alex Ferguson

Former Tottenham manager Tim Sherwood said fans are “blessed” to have someone like Man City boss Pep Guardiola in the Premier League.

Tim Sherwood has claimed that Manchester City boss Pep Guardiola is the best Premier League manager of all time ahead of Manchester United legend Sir Alex Ferguson.

Guardiola has had a lasting impact during his respective management spells at Barcelona, Bayern Munich and City, with the Spaniard widely hailed for his incredible success.

The former Bayern and Barcelona head coach arrived at City in 2016 and hoovered up major silverware at domestic level in England.

Guardiola has led City to four Premier League titles, an FA Cup and four League Cups during his prolific spell, with only the Champions League trophy eluding him during his time at the Etihad.

The 52-year-old City manager led his side to a historic domestic treble during the 2018-19 season, while Guardiola’s side also secured a record-breaking 100 points in their 2017-18 Premier League title win.

Speaking on talkSPORT, Sherwood has insisted that fans are “blessed” to have a world-class manager like Guardiola in England’s top-flight domestic league.

“I mean, Pep Guardiola, for me, is the best coach we’ve ever had in the Premier League,” he said.

“I think Sir Alex Ferguson… Sir Alex Ferguson is the best manager by far because he stands up there with anyone but I’m talking about actual coach, someone who’s turning the page over every single week.

“You know, trying something different, teaching everyone something different -- incredible, incredible.

“Doesn’t want to reinvent a wheel. What he does is play players in positions where he thinks it suits them and gets the best out of them.”

When talkSPORT host Andy Goldstein suggested Guardiola ‘tinkers’ too much in big matches, Sherwood responded: “I think you take as highlighted when it’s in the Champions League final, he tinkers in every game.

“What he does, when you’ve got players of that quality, Andy, you can tinker, you can do what you want.

“I mean, you still got a win -- there is lot of people who have had the money down the years and not been able to win.

“This guy knows how to win on a regular basis but not only that, he entertains us. I mean, we’re blessed to have someone like Pep Guardiola in the Premier League.”
